Controversial #JackdawGasField set to be approved in weeks, sources say
Simon Jack, 3 September 2026
"The #UK government is set to give the go-ahead for a controversial new #GasField off the coast of #Aberdeen, the BBC understands.
"Approval for the Jackdaw project could come in mid-September, just before #Parliament breaks for party conference season, according to government and industry sources.
"The gas field was approved by the former #ConservativeGovernment in 2022 but was delayed by a legal ruling from a #ScottishCourt, after #EnvironmentalGroups argued consent was given without fully considering the #ClimateImpact.
"Jackdaw's owner says it will account for 6% of UK gas output when at peak production but environmental groups say it will provide only 2% of UK use when imports are included.
"Campaigners launched legal challenges after Jackdaw was approved in 2022 and when the #RosebankOilField off #Shetland was given the green light in 2023.
"The Court of Session in Edinburgh ruled last year that #Rosebank and Jackdaw had been unlawfully approved because the government had failed to take into account the climate impact of burning extracted #OilAndGas from the sites.
"A judge ruled that more detailed climate assessments had to be published, and further estimates were put out for consultation in July.
"Both Jackdaw and Rosebank are operated by #Adura, a joint venture between energy giants #ShellOil and Norway's #Equinor. Aberdeen-based firm Ithaca also owns 20% of Rosebank.
"Adura has estimated that Jackdaw could produce 35.8m tonnes of carbon over its 11-year lifetime, the equivalent of 90% of Scotland's emissions for 2023. But it said a more likely estimate was about 23.6m tonnes - equivalent to 60% of the 2023 figure.
" #Environmentalists insist that more #drilling would be unconscionable, hampering efforts to cut planet-warming carbon emissions as deadly #heatwaves and #ExtremeWeather affect billions across the globe.
"They also say starting production would not protect energy security and that transitioning sooner to #GreenerTechnologies would be better for supporting jobs."

Documents shed light on the earliest-known instance of #ClimateScience funded by the #FossilFuel industry, adding to growing understanding of #BigOil ’s knowledge of #ClimateChange . Fossil fuel industry sponsored climate science in 1954.
February 1, 2024, Rebecca John
Excerpt: "Unknown until now, however, is the fact that Keeling’s earliest research into carbon dioxide across the western U.S. was funded in part by the fossil fuel industry via a private foundation — and that in 1954 this foundation was informed of the potential impact of manmade carbon dioxide emissions on both the climate and human civilization.
"Newly discovered documents affirm that the #automobile and #petroleum industries funded early climate science #Keeling conducted at the California Institute of Technology (Caltech) between 1954 and 1956. Records show that 'oil and auto companies' sponsored the scientist’s research via an organization called the Southern California Air Pollution Foundation, formed in 1953 to tackle Los Angeles’s infamous smog. American Motors, #Chrysler, #Ford, and #GeneralMotors were among 18 automotive companies that gave money to the foundation.
"A 1959 internal U.S. Public Health Service memo also identifies the #AmericanPetroleumInstitute ( #API ) and the #WesternOilAndGasAssociation — the oldest petroleum trade association in the U.S., which is now known as the #WesternStatesPetroleumAssociation — as 'major contributors to the funds of the Air Pollution Foundation.' Its Board of Trustees included top-level representatives from the Southern California Gas Company, the Southern California Edison Co., Chrysler, General Motors, and Union Oil (now #Chevron).
"And from mid-1955, these trustees were also appraised of research projects by a seven-man 'technical advisory committee,' which included a senior official from API as well as scientists from the Richfield Oil Corporation (now #BP ) and #Chrysler.
"With the discovery of these Air Pollution Foundation documents, it is now possible to date the earliest sponsorship of climate science by the fossil fuel industry to 1954, approximately a quarter of a century before Exxon’s internal research program of the late 1970s. These new documents provide important evidence that the fossil fuel industry has been intricately connected to climate science from its earliest beginnings — not only as a driver of the greenhouse effect behind climate change, but also as a contributor to the scientific discoveries that would transform our understanding of humanity’s relationship with the Earth and its atmosphere. Could #Maine make polluters pay for the cost of #climateChange ? Lawmakers want to study it first.
The Legislature on Tuesday passed a measure to study how much greenhouse gas emissions are costing the state, with Republicans opposed.
by Rachel Ohm, March 31, 2026
"Maine lawmakers Tuesday took a possible step toward establishing a program to recoup money from large, corporate polluters to pay for the impacts of climate change.
"The House of Representatives passed a bill that would study how much greenhouse gas emissions have cost the state in a 75-72 vote that fell largely along party lines. Two Democrats, Tiffany Roberts of South Berwick and Holly Sargent of York, joined with Republicans in opposition.
"The Senate passed the bill 19-13 earlier in the week with Democrats in support and Republicans opposed.
"The bill, LD 1870, sponsored by Sen. Stacy Brenner, D-Scarborough, started out as a proposal for a so-called #ClimateSuperfund that would collect fees from groups that extract #FossilFuels and refine crude oil and whose activities are found to contribute to certain levels of greenhouse gas emissions. The money would be used to fund climate change adaptation projects.
The version that was voted on this week, however, was revised to a proposal for a study of the cost to the state of greenhouse gas emissions from 1995 to 2024. The information is set to be submitted to lawmakers in a report due by Jan. 1, 2028."Archived version:

Peer-Reviewed Study Exposes How #BigTech and #BigOil Work ‘Hand-in-Glove’ to Profit Off #AI
“New research confirms: AI, on sum, is a loser for #GlobalClimate.”
by Jessica Corbett
Aug 11, 2026Excerpt: "Welcoming the study, Clara Vondrich, senior policy counsel for the Climate Program at the watchdog group #PubliCitizen, said that 'this research exposes #BigTech as a lead accomplice to the #FossilFuel industry in ways we never imagined. It’s bad enough that communities are being hammered by rising energy bills as data centers gobble up insane amounts of fossil fuel power, but now we see that those emissions are just a fraction of the #ClimateHarms Big Tech is responsible for.'
" 'To be clear, oil companies are not simply using publicly available AI tools: Big Tech is entering into bilateral contracts with oil companies, and selling them proprietary tools specifically designed for the purpose of accelerating oil production,' Vondrich stressed. “You can’t make this up: Big Tech companies, self-avowed climate champs for decades, are working hand-in-glove with Big Oil to find, dig, and burn more fossil fuels to make a buck.”
" 'AI’s promise as a tool for advancing solutions to the #ClimateCrisis is fading as a cruel reality takes shape: Big tech companies are selling AI to the fossil fuel industry to accelerate our demise so they can turn a profit,' she added. 'These are the perverse outcomes resulting from our rigged market economy: access to cutting-edge AI goes to the highest bidder and Big Oil has some of the deepest pockets in the world. Meanwhile the externalities—runaway climate change manifesting this summer as historic #HeatDomes and fires—are never counted, except as body counts. Today, Big Tech is Big Oil’s number one accomplice.' "

Major #OilCompanies reap massive profits as US and Iran fighting drives energy prices higher
By CATHY BUSSEWITZ
Updated 11:11 AM EDT, July 31, 2026NEW YORK (AP) — "American oil and gas giants raked in massive spring profits while fighting between Iran and the U.S. impeded petroleum shipments and consumers around the world paid more for fuel and confronted shortages.
"The conflict, now in its sixth month, halted most shipping through the Strait of Hormuz, a narrow waterway that previously served as a delivery route for a fifth of the world’s oil and natural gas. With global supplies constrained, prices for Brent crude, the international standard, soared from about $70 to above $100 a barrel for much of March, April and May, and at one point reached $126.
"The money that oil companies accrued between the beginning of April and the end of June could receive extra scrutiny this year. Gasoline, diesel and jet fuel prices climbed sharply during that period, increasing costs for drivers and airline passengers. Supplies ran low in some countries, leading to sporadic fuel rationing in #Australia and government office closures in #Nepal and #SriLanka.
" #ExxonMobil on Friday reported that its second quarter profits doubled to $14.53 billion, boosted by record diesel production. The oil giant, based in Spring, Texas, brought in $116.02 billion in revenue, up 42%.
" #Chevron, based in Houston, nearly quadrupled its profits to $12.07 billion and revenue jumped 56% to $70.06 billion.
"Six of #Europe’s largest oil companies posted combined first-quarter profits of $22 billion, more than 40% higher than last year.
" 'There are constituencies around the world who are having a very good crisis, and the oil producers are one of them,' said Patrick Galey, #FossilFuels lead at #GlobalWitness, a nonprofit organization that investigates environmental issues. 'When you compare that to the hundreds of millions of people who are struggling with #RollingBlackouts, with #ElectricityCurbs, #rationing, waiting in line for #FoodQueues, or the disruption to fertilizers and the potential impact that that has on food prices, we don’t think that it’s a justifiable price for the rest of the world to be paying.' The report #OilCompanies are worried about: #ClimateAttribution science
New report says our ability to tie weather damages to #ClimateChange is improving.
John Timmer – Jul 17, 2026
Excerpt: "Climate change is being driven largely by the greenhouse gases we’ve pumped into the atmosphere, which trap more of the Sun’s energy there. That added energy increases the odds of extreme events: longer, more intense heat waves and droughts, interspersed with excessive precipitation. But these sorts of events have happened in the past—how can we tell if any given weather disaster has been made more likely by the climate?
"It’s a question with implications for everything from building codes to disaster preparedness. And there’s some good news: According to a report released by the US National Academies of Science on Thursday, the field of climate attribution is growing increasingly mature and can answer some questions for us with far greater confidence than it could just a decade ago. The report also notes that there are still important limits and suggests steps to address them.
"Overall, this makes it clear that climate attribution is normal, mainstream science. And the #FossilFuel industry views that as a problem, as it could make it easier to hold companies liable for damages. This has triggered a backlash that has Republicans in Congress and state governments threatening the National Academies’ funding."

Licensed to drill? How a #Trump-linked Texas #OilCompany is elbowing its way into #Greenland
#GreenlandEnergy says billions of barrels of crude could lie beneath territory and claims it has permission to bring drilling kit ashore – a claim denied by #Nuuk
by Tom Burgis, 9 Jul 2026
"On 10 June, a snowy-haired American in his 60s addressed the residents of a remote Greenland hamlet. He was there to tell them about a business venture supported by figures linked to Donald Trump. 'So,' Robert Price said via an interpreter, 'we have a project to drill for oil here.'
"The Texas oil company that Price represents, Greenland Energy, hopes to prove that billions of barrels of crude lie underground by bringing in 300 shipping containers of drilling kit.
" 'We have the permit to put the equipment on the land,' footage of the gathering in Ittoqqortoormiit shows Price saying. 'And then we’ve filed our permits – pending approval – to drill.'
"But Greenland’s resources ministry said that contrary to Price’s claim, there were
'no actually active permissions for any exploration activity or permissions for preparations for these activities'."The dispute threatens a showdown between the Trump-linked backers of Greenland Energy and the authorities in the vast, sparsely populated territory. Trump’s lieutenants are using the prospect of an American oil find in Greenland to bolster their case for an American takeover."
[...]
"The wells are expected to be drilled in an area protected by the global #RamsarConvention to preserve #wetlands. David Boertmann, an expert on Greenland’s birds, said the #ConservationZone hosts important numbers of barnacle geese and pink-footed geese as well as whimbrel, golden plover, Sabine’s gull and snowy owl, plus #muskoxen. Oil exploration activities could threaten the birds’ habitat, Boertmann said."

#ExtremeHeat Isn’t the Only Climate Impact Shocking Scientists
By Eric Roston and Hayley Warren, July 6, 2026
"Much of the US just sweltered through the July 4 holiday weekend as an intense heat dome bore down, straining power grids and prompting the cancellation of many events. Washington, DC, saw a high of 102F (39C) on Saturday, a new local record for the date. In Europe, punishing temperatures are set to return days after a deadly heat wave pushed thermometers as high as 43.8C (111F) in #France. A troubling pattern has emerged in this summer’s heat: Not only has it broken records, it’s done so often by margins far above the previous all-time highs.
"These heat jumps are part of a larger shift of #ClimateChange seeming to accelerate. #OceanTemperatures just reached a new high for the early summer. #SeaLevels are rising faster than before, while new records for daily rainfall are being set at a rapid clip. The pace of #GlobalWarming itself has quickened in recent years.
"While scientists have long braced for climate change, the growing severity of its impacts is shocking them.
"Today’s climate can 'seem like an unexpected step change' from that of a few years ago, said atmospheric scientist Katharine Hayhoe of Texas Tech University.
"Climate models from decades ago have proved prescient, closely aligning with what the mercury later showed: heat increasing around the planet, caused primarily by humans burning #fossilfuels ."

For #Indigenous communities in ‘#Alberta,’ the #OilIndustry has left an ugly stain
Facing #OilSpills, evacuations and #illness — nations downstream of the #OilSands grieve their way of life, as the #corporations polluting their water get richer
By Brandi Morin, December 7, 2023
Excerpt: "The rush of the wind and sprays of water add to the thrill as Jason Castor guides his riverboat through a stretch of #LakeAthabasca near #FortChipewyan, in #Treaty8 territories. If he slows down, his boat could get stuck in the mud or even flip over because the water levels in this spot are remarkably low. He steers around buoys, dodges logs and other debris while accelerating to the mouth of the channel, which he knows should be deep enough to navigate at an average speed.
"While trawling his boat further down the river, Castor points to odd-looking clusters resembling dirty foam floating by.
" 'There’s just a slurry of a foam that looks like #oil or some kind of #chemical in there,' says Castor, a 42-year-old father, construction business owner and member of the #AthabascaChipewyan #FirstNation (#ACFN).
"He’s been a traditional hunter, trapper and fisherman for nearly 20 years and has documented strange changes in the water, the land and animals.
"Something’s going on in the river, he says.
" 'They say that it’s natural, well, I know that that’s not natural because I’ve been on the river my whole life,' he explains as he points to brown and #WhiteFoam, #OilSheens and other discoloured formations floating on the river.
"Nowadays, it’s risky to navigate these waterways because of industrial intakes like the #WACBennettDam to the west in B.C.; the #AlbertaOilSands just up the river and impacts from #ClimateChange.
"The #PeaceAthabascaDelta is the second-largest #freshwater delta in the world.
"The #AthabascaRiver, and the larger delta, also sit atop the world’s largest known reservoir of #CrudeBitumen.
"The industry that has sprung up around it drives Alberta’s and Canada’s economy, employing about 138,000 people. In 2021, crude bitumen production totaled approximately 3.3 million barrels per day. The oil sands energy sector including oil sands, conventional #OilAndGas, mining and quarrying is valued at about $18 billion.
"But while Canada prospers off the oil sands industry, #Indigenous communities downstream are dealing with its #toxic impacts.
"Not only are the water levels fluctuating, but the health of the water flowing through the Athabasca River is jeopardized."

#OnionLake #CreeNation to proceed with its legal challenge of #Alberta sovereignty act
By Lisa Johnson The Canadian Press, May 15, 2025
EDMONTON - "Alberta’s bill lowering the bar for a separation referendum has spurred a #FirstNation to push ahead with a legal challenge against the premier’s flagship sovereignty act.
"Danielle Smith has said her Alberta Sovereignty Within a United Canada Act is needed to push back on what the province believes is unconstitutional federal encroachment into provincial jurisdiction.
"But Onion Lake Cree Nation Chief #HenryLewis said that law has always been about undermining federal authority and asserting provincial control, which goes against his community’s #Treaty6 relationship with the Crown." 'I want to respectfully remind the premier that this land that we stand on today is #Treaty land and is not yours to take or make sweeping decisions about,” he said at a news conference in Edmonton on Thursday.
"He announced the legal challenge is moving forward a day after Smith’s government passed a bill significantly lowering the threshold for citizens to prompt a referendum, including one on seceding from Canada."
